Corvinus Skyline™ is the condensed version of Corvinus designed by Imre Reiner in 1932 for the Bauer Type Foundry. This revival was designed by Ann Pomeroy in the early 90s. Corvinus Skyline is a condensed, formal face with a very retro look.

Poster Gothic was inspired by showcard lettering samples featured in the book,"Commercial Art of Show Card Lettering" by James Eisenberg, published by D. Van Nostrand Company in 1945.

Cooper Poster was inspired by showcard lettering samples featured in the book, Commercial Art Of Show Card Lettering, published in 1945. Although named "Western", the design was modeled after Ozwald Cooper's 1921 original Cooper Black.

Caslon Antique is a decorative American typeface that was designed in 1894 by Berne Nadall.

Bristol and Bristol Adornado (also known as Greco) was first released by Fundición Richard Gans of Madrid, Spain, in 1925. The Richard Gans Foundry is a defunct Spanish foundry which existed from 1888-1975.

Originally designed by Sol Hess for the Lanston Monotype Foundry in 1938 as a fat face, this monoline revival was designed by Ann Pomeroy in the early 90s. Spire is extra condensed with a very retro look.

If there was an American Typeface Hall of Fame, Bank Gothic, designed by the great Morris Fuller Benton would hold a place of special distinction considering this design has survived so many trends in typographic fashion since being introduced in 1930.

This 1957 typeface, designed by F.H.E. Schneidler for the Bauer Type Foundry, was created to compliment his Schneidler Old Style, (also known as Bauer Text). Schneidler Initials have pointed and very small serifs.
